Store cooked meatballs and tzatziki sauce in separate airtight containers in the refrigerator for up to 5 days to prevent sogginess. Freeze cooked meatballs for up to 3 months. Reheat in 325-degree oven for 8 minutes or microwave with a splash of water for 90 seconds. Make tzatziki up to 2 days ahead. Each serving contains 32g protein. Can substitute ground lamb or beef. Dried dill works if fresh is unavailable.
